Digitalising accounts payable: what actually works

The classic digitalisation traps are avoidable: scanning without quality control (unreadable records), stacking disconnected tools (double entry in disguise), or neglecting access rights. One single flow from document to entry, with clear roles, beats five shiny apps.

For an SME in Erlach, the real gain of digitalised accounts payable shows day to day: no paper pile at month-end, VAT prepared continuously, and an owner reading today's figures rather than last quarter's.

Outsource accounts payable or keep it in-house?

Outsourcing does not exempt you from understanding: an owner who can read the balance sheet and the income statement challenges the fiduciary better — and pays for advice, not re-keying.

Changing fiduciary is not a drama: the accounting data belongs to the company, and a clean export (entries, chart of accounts, linked documents) allows a transition at year-end. A provider who locks in a client's data says a lot about how it works.

A well-structured SME chart of accounts

The test of a good chart of accounts is a single question: can the owner find the margins in three clicks? If not, the chart serves the tax office but not the business — even in Erlach.

Suspense accounts (to clarify) are useful provided they are emptied monthly: a swelling “miscellaneous” account is the classic symptom of a chart that no longer fits the activity.

Which social contributions does a Swiss employer pay?

AHV/IV/APG: 5.3% employer share (the same is withheld from the employee); unemployment insurance: 1.1% each up to CHF 148,200 a year; occupational pension (LPP) by age and plan (employer at least 50%); occupational accident insurance paid by the employer; family allowances by canton. When must a business register for VAT?

As soon as its worldwide annual turnover reaches CHF 100,000 (CHF 250,000 for non-profit sports or cultural associations). Below that, voluntary registration remains possible and often makes sense to reclaim input VAT on investments. The threshold is federal: it applies in Erlach as everywhere in Switzerland.

What are the current Swiss VAT rates?

Since 1 January 2024: 8.1% (standard), 2.6% (reduced — for example food and medicines) and 3.8% (accommodation). Returns must be filed and paid within 60 days after the period ends (quarterly under the effective method, semi-annually under the net tax rate method).
